CAS Number:124584-08-3Molecular Formula:C143H244N50O42S4Molecular Weight:3464.1Purity:> 95%Chemical Structure:H-Ser-Pro-Lys-Met-Val-Gln-Gly-Ser-Gly-Cys-Phe-Gly-Arg-Lys-Met-Asp-Arg-Ile-Ser-Ser-Ser-Ser-Gly-Leu-Gly-Cys-Lys-Val-Leu-Arg-Arg-His-OH (Disulfide bridge Cys10-Cys26)Application:The secretion of the cardiac hormone BNP-32 is increased considerably in patients with congestive heart failure, successful medical treatment of this condition will result in a decrease. Yandle et al. described a method for determining hBNP in human plasma. Effects of hBNP infusion in humans have been described by Holmes et al and La Villa et al. BNP is an important biomarker in the diagnosis of heart diseases. Additionally, BNP-32 may act as a neuropeptide. BNP-32 exerts strong lipolytic effects in humans.Storage/Stability:Shipped at 4°C.
